Pros

Absolutely NOTHING, at all levels. Housekeepers -go to a hotel, you will make more money. Account Managers, barely 10 -11 per hour for being a housekeeper ALL day.

Cons

PAY --Fast Food / retail pays better No integrity - if they promise it, they are Lying No quality of life for managers. If your short staffed, your expected to do that position, and get your job done. It's not M-F. Because hourly workers call out on weekends, your expected to cover. If a client does not like you, your thrown under the bus. This is for all levels of employees, transferred, because your the wind blows. Years before you will ever see a promotion. Raises are a Joke! Salary of $23,000 for Account Managers. District Pay is no better $30-32K. They target college grads because the pay is extremely low. They have been sued multiple times for hiring practices, compensation, sexually harassment, and hostile work environment. Never, ever work for this company, unless you plan on treating it like a Staffing company --get a few checks then RUN for your life!! Toxic as Hell! Evil, hateful, destructive, deceptive. I honestly can say, the WORSE working environment I've ever had. Lying is the an ingrained part of their culture. No computers available for account Managers --everything is faxed! If your clients fax or copier is down your expected to use your own money at a Kinkos. Background checks for new hires can take 7-10 days, while your short-staffed. No HR resource to assist with staffing and recruiting. No set standard of SOP. You have countless manuals, that your superiors have never read. Training on all levels does not exist. A few hours, then everyone from housekeepers, laundry, account managers, District Managers are expected to be experts. No support from superiors. Because everyone is afraid, they are quick to backstab. Do your research, on glass door and Indeed reviews. Pretty consistent that this company lacks Integrity. Negative 10 is my true rating.
